The first issue sounds like motion detection is not enabled. That would explain why tagging is not working and no notifications are being sent. You could try disabling motion detection and tagging and re-enabling them if you haven’t already, or power cycle the camera and see if it starts working.

The second issue is likely due to the removal of the hardware decoder in the Android version of the Wyze app. You can try rolling back to the older version of the app and see if that resolves the issue with lag:

You may also get more responsiveness by switching from HD quality to SD or 360p. I’m using mine in 360p mode since I haven’t rolled back my app.
